Job Description
As a Senior Cost Manager, you will be responsible for leading the cost management and estimating process for engineering systems across major construction and infrastructure projects.
Key Responsibilities:
* Develop and deliver accurate and detailed cost plans for building services (mechanical, electrical, fire, hydraulics)
* Lead pre- and post-contract cost management services on high-value projects
* Provide guidance on procurement strategies, risk management, and value engineering to ensure optimal project outcomes
* Conduct benchmarking, feasibility studies, and design cost analysis to inform decision-making
* Review contractor claims, variations, and manage progress assessments to maintain project timelines and budgets
* Collaborate closely with clients, consultants, and subcontractors to drive project success and foster a culture of collaboration and knowledge-sharing
Requirements:
* Hold professional qualifications in engineering, quantity surveying, building services, or construction management
* Possess extensive experience in cost estimation and management of engineering services
* Have a strong technical understanding of building services systems across sectors
* Be able to lead complex projects with minimal supervision and demonstrate strong leadership skills
* Possess excellent client-facing skills and the ability to manage stakeholder expectations and communicate effectively
* Demonstrate advanced proficiency in cost planning software and Microsoft Office
* Hold Australian citizenship or be willing to obtain it due to defence work requirements
